Calculating Net Present Value and Net Future Value

The net present value (NPV) function is used to discount all cash flows to the front of the time line using an annual nominal interest rate that you supply.

To calculate NPV or NFV:

1.Press ]O:and store the desired number of periods per year in P/YR.

2.Enter the cash flow data.

3.Store the annual nominal interest rate in I/YR and press .

4.If you have just calculated NPV, press to calculate NFV.

The HP 10bII+ Financial Calculator is a versatile and powerful tool designed to meet the needs of finance students, professionals, and anyone involved in financial planning and analysis. Known for its compactness and user-friendly interface, this calculator incorporates a range of features specifically tailored for financial calculations, making it an essential gadget for banking, real estate, and investment analysis.

At the heart of the HP 10bII+ is its ability to perform a wide variety of financial functions, including time value of money calculations, cash flow analysis, bond pricing, and depreciation. Its built-in functions facilitate the computation of interest rates, present and future values, net present value (NPV), internal rate of return (IRR), and annuities. This array of functionalities allows users to tackle complex financial problems with ease.
